public class Accommodation extends LineItem
| Modifier and Type | Field and Description |
|---|---|
static java.lang.String |
LineItemTypeValue |
_AVPList, _batchNumber, _billingCostCentre, _creditLineIndicator, _despatchInformation, _destination, _lineItemId, _note, _origin, _price, _quantity, _receiptAllowanceCharges, _serialNumber, _taxes, _tradeItemDescriptionInformation, _tradeItemIdentification, _tradeItemMeasurements, _transactionalTradeItemCode, _transactionalTradeItemType, LineItemTypeIdentifier| Constructor and Description |
|---|
Accommodation(AccommodationType accommodationType,
java.lang.String provider,
java.lang.String shortDescription,
java.lang.String longDescription,
int nights,
double rate) |
Accommodation(TradeItemDescriptionInformation tradeItemDescriptionInformation,
int quantity,
double price) |
| Modifier and Type | Method and Description |
|---|---|
AccommodationType |
getAccommodationType() |
java.util.Date |
getArrivalDate() |
java.util.Date |
getDepartureDate() |
java.lang.String |
getDetailedDescription() |
java.lang.String |
getProviderName() |
java.lang.String |
getShortDescription() |
void |
setArrivalDate(java.util.Date arrivalDate) |
void |
setDepartureDate(java.util.Date departureDate) |
void |
setPassengerName(java.lang.String passengerName) |
addEcomAVP, addReceiptAllowanceCharges, addTax, addTradeItemIdentification, getAllowancesTotal, getBatchNumber, getBillingCostCentre, getBrandName, getDeliveryDate, getDeliveryInstructions, getDescription, getDespatchDate, getDespatchInformation, getDestinationInformation, getEcomAVPList, getLineItemId, getLineItemType, getName, getNetTotal, getNote, getOriginInformation, getPrice, getQuantity, getReceiptAllowanceCharges, getSerialNumber, getSubTotal, getTaxes, getTaxesTotal, getTaxesTotal, getTotal, getTradeItemDescriptionInformation, getTradeItemIdentification, getTradeItemIdentificationValue, getTradeItemMeasurements, getTransactionalTradeItemCode, getTransactionalTradeItemType, hasNote, hasTaxes, hasTradeItemIdentificationValue, isReturnOrExchange, setBatchNumber, setBillingCostCentre, setDeliveryDate, setDeliveryInstructions, setDespatchDate, setDespatchInformation, setDestinationInformation, setLineItemId, setMeasurements, setNetContent, setNote, setOriginInformation, setPrice, setQuantity, setReturnOrExchange, setSerialNumber, setTradeItemDescriptionInformation, setTradeItemDescriptionInformation, setTradeItemGroupIdentificationCode, setTradeItemIdentification, setTradeItemMeasurements, setTransactionalTradeItemTypepublic static final java.lang.String LineItemTypeValue
public Accommodation(AccommodationType accommodationType, java.lang.String provider, java.lang.String shortDescription, java.lang.String longDescription, int nights, double rate)
public Accommodation(TradeItemDescriptionInformation tradeItemDescriptionInformation, int quantity, double price)
public java.lang.String getProviderName()
public java.lang.String getShortDescription()
public java.lang.String getDetailedDescription()
public AccommodationType getAccommodationType()
public void setPassengerName(java.lang.String passengerName)
public java.util.Date getDepartureDate()
public void setDepartureDate(java.util.Date departureDate)
public java.util.Date getArrivalDate()
public void setArrivalDate(java.util.Date arrivalDate)